
Mandy Parker
Lead Partner, Assessment and Development
Mandy recently joined GatenbySanderson to lead on assignments, both locally and nationally, spanning the public sector.
She has 20 years experience in psychometric assessment and assessment centre methodology, with the last six years focusing on senior level posts in Central and Local Government, plus agencies. Before joining GatenbySanderson, she was a senior manager at KPMG, which involved leading on large scale assessment and development projects, including the Department of Health, where she has assessed over 400 Senior Civil Servants.
Her career began in human resources, and she is a chartered member of the CIPD. Latterly she trained as an occupational psychologist and has since specialised in the design of assessment and development centres, including bespoke exercise design. Having worked for a major psychometric test publisher and psychology consultancy, she is trained in, and has access, to the majority of the reputable personality instruments and ability tests on the market.
With a keen focus on quality and providing added value for clients in the recruitment and selection process of high calibre candidates, she promotes best practice in the use of assessments and contributed to the British Psychological Society’s guidelines on this subject. Providing a positive experience for candidates and ensuring final panel members have objective and accessibly presented information to use in their deliberations is a particular focus.
